Děcko
Děcko (English: Child) is a Czech family drama series directed by Rozália Kohoutová and Radim Špaček. Story was written by Kateřina Krobová and Lucie Macháčková. It is broadcast by Czech Television in the spring of 2025.[1][2] SynopsisSingle mother Klára is pregnant for the third time. Manipulative while ex-husband Adam wants to sue her for custody over younger son Daník. Older daughter Zorka needs her mother even more the more she runs away from her. Under economic pressure, Klára decides to embark on a thin ice of direct adoption. Her fate gradually begins to intertwine with fates of four couples – with the divorcing Alice and Michal, same-sex registered couple Petr and Vladimír, the seemingly superficial influencers Beáta and Hubert, and older partners Hanka and Kryštof. All of them strive in different ways for the possibility of surrogate parenthood and carry their own fate while character of unorthodox social worker Jarmil Čáp connects them all and covers the topic of surrogate family care.
